In parallel to characterizing the conversation between conolidine and ACKR3, the two groups went a step further more. The scientists developed a modified variant of conolidine — which they termed “RTI-5152-12” — which exclusively binds to ACKR3 with a fair higher affinity. It's been called mother nature's morphine by some. The rationale for this novel title is the fact that thus far, conolidine has offered considerable pain relief with very few Uncomfortable side effects which have been normal of opioids like morphine and codeine. It's because the molecular construction is not rather like that of an opioid. It, thus, behaves just a little in another way in the body. Early screening has revealed that conolidine does not exhibit the GI distress or addictive attributes the opioid family members of pain relievers have.
This compound was also analyzed for mu-opioid receptor action, and like conolidine, was located to acquire no action at the positioning. Using the exact same paw injection take a look at, various alternatives with larger efficacy ended up located that inhibited the initial pain reaction, indicating opiate-like action. Provided the different mechanisms of those conolidine derivatives, it absolutely was also suspected they would provide this analgesic outcome devoid of mimicking opiate Unintended effects (63). Exactly the same group synthesized additional conolidine derivatives, getting an extra compound known as 15a that had very similar Qualities and didn't bind the mu-opioid receptor (sixty six).

Besides modulating ACKR3, some experiments prompt that conolidine might also inhibit calcium ion channels. This implies a multi-qualified pain relief approach which would entail targeting a number of facets of the pain signaling pathway. This twin action might enable it to be simpler regarding managing a wider choice of pain disorders.
Conolidine is a natural alkaloid derived from your bark with the tropical shrub Tabernaemontana divaricata, also referred to as crepe jasmine. This shrub was traditionally Employed in Chinese, Ayurvedic, and Thai drugs, and is also well-known for its potent pain-relieving Homes.
Early investigations into conolidine’s analgesic properties are actually carried out in animal designs. Rodent experiments have proven considerable reductions in pain responses following conolidine administration. In thermal and mechanical pain assays, such as the very hot plate and von Frey filament tests, handled animals exhibited extended latency to pain stimuli, suggesting a tangible analgesic result. Notably, these consequences occurred devoid of sedation or motor impairment, popular drawbacks of opioid-dependent analgesics.
